Step-by-step: sign-up, verify, and avoid common delays

  1. Create an account with accurate details. Use the name and address that match your ID. Mistakes here are the main cause of later payout problems.
  2. Verify ID and address immediately. Upload a photo ID (passport or driver licence) and a proof of address (bank statement or utility bill). Do this before you deposit — it speeds withdrawals.
  3. Pick deposit methods used by Kiwis. Choose methods you trust: local e-wallets, debit cards, or bank transfers. Check processing times and fees.

How to read bonuses so they help you, not trap you

Bonuses look attractive until you read the wagering conditions. Here’s the focused checklist to use before accepting any offer:

  • Wagering requirement: divide the bonus amount by the playthrough multiplier to estimate how much you must stake.
  • Eligible games: slots often count 100% towards playthrough while many table games count less; check the percentages.
  • Max bet rules: some offers cap bet size while a bonus is active — exceeding it voids winnings.
  • Expiry: know the bonus lifetime (days or weeks) and plan sessions accordingly.

Choosing games with the best chance of reaching withdrawals

Not all casino games behave the same against wagering conditions. Use this practical game-strategy:

  • Slots for speed: high RTP slots let you meet wagering requirements faster, but variance can still swing outcomes — prefer medium volatility if you need steadier results.
  • Avoid low-contribution games: roulette, baccarat and many blackjack variants often contribute little or nothing to wagering—you’ll waste time and money chasing requirements.
  • Check game rules for max win caps: some bonuses cap the amount you can cash out from bonus wins.

Smart bankroll rules — a 3-rule system that works

Replace vague limits with three clear rules you can actually follow:

  • Set a session loss limit equal to 2–5% of your monthly entertainment budget; stop when you hit it.
  • Use fixed bet sizing: no more than 1–2% of your session bankroll per spin or hand.
  • Cashout rule: whenever you’re up 50% or more of your session stake, withdraw half of the profit to avoid tilt losses.

Withdrawal tips — reduce friction and waiting time

Most delays happen because sites request extra documents or because you try to withdraw via a different method than you used to deposit. Avoid this by:

  • Verifying identity before making a deposit.
  • Using the same payment method for withdrawal where possible.
  • Checking minimum withdrawal amounts and processing times on the cashier page before you play.

Customer support and dispute steps

If you hit a problem with a transaction or a frozen account, do this in order:

  1. Open a support ticket and request a clear case number.
  2. Escalate via live chat if the ticket stalls — insist on getting the compliance team’s expected turnaround time.
  3. If unresolved, collect timestamps, screenshots, transaction IDs and escalate to a recognised dispute resolution service active in the site’s licensing jurisdiction.
